Mesothelioma Lawsuits

A lawyer will pinpoint the companies responsible for you exposure and file a suit. The defendants will have a certain amount of time after filing to respond.

The compensation from a mesothelioma lawsuit will help you, your family and friends pay for medical expenses and lost wages. Settlements may also provide compensation for pain and suffering.

Damages

A mesothelioma lawsuit that is successful may result in a significant amount of compensation. The purpose of this award is to help victims pay for the financial burdens associated with the disease. This can include medical costs loss of wages, pain and suffering.

Patients suffering from mesothelioma are able to be compensated in three ways: VA benefits, payments from asbestos trust fund and an agreement from their asbestos lawsuit. Mesothelioma verdicts are less frequent than settlements, but every case is different and could be a better option for trial in certain cases.

Asbestos sufferers often have to fight for fair compensation. The litigation process may take years before a decision is reached. However, trials provide the chance to increase amount of compensation and to hold asbestos companies responsible in court.

The litigation process includes a discovery phase, where both parties share information and depositions in order to build their case. A seasoned mesothelioma attorney understands how to use this evidence to obtain mesothelioma settlements that are fair.

A mesothelioma case can make the asbestos company accountable for punitive damages, which are awarded if the defendant has committed fraud or malice. These additional damages can make an enormous difference in a patient's health and their family's financial situation.

Medical expenses can quickly pile up for mesothelioma patients. Many sufferers are not able to work due to their mesothelioma, which results in a loss of earnings. A mesothelioma trial verdict or settlement could provide victims with the funds they require to cover these costs and take care of their families.

In some states, like New York, the statute of limitations to bring Mesothelioma Claims (Lovewiki.Faith) is two years after diagnosis or at the time of death for wrongful-death suits. Therefore, it is crucial to start a claim as soon as you can.

Settlements

A mesothelioma case seeks monetary compensation from the companies accountable for asbestos exposure. Compensation can help families and patients pay for funeral expenses, medical bills, lost income and other costs. Asbestos sufferers can also receive compensation for their suffering and pain. In addition, the lawsuit could seek punitive damages that penalize defendants for their negligence as well as to deter similar behavior.

Asbestos victims often receive settlements of millions of dollars or more. The amount of money paid varies by case, as there are many variables that could affect the final amount. The number of defendants, for instance can affect the amount of settlement.

The amount of mesothelioma compensation paid to the victim or their family is also determined by the severity of the condition and the manner in which it was caused. Asbestos cancers, such as mesothelioma, tend to be more severe and life-threatening than non-cancerous diseases such as asbestosis. A mesothelioma lawyer of the top quality can look over the patient's work or military history to determine when and how asbestos exposure occurred. A top mesothelioma lawyer can make use of this information to construct a strong case for the maximum amount of settlement.

Because of the risk of losing a trial defendants tend to settle rather than go to trial. However, a mesothelioma case may be tried if the client wants to go to trial. A mesothelioma lawyer could provide expert witnesses to their client in the event of a court trial.

The verdicts in trials can be more expensive than settlements for mesothelioma as jurors may award more if a defendant has been negligent. However, verdicts are not guaranteed and may be reduced through an agreement with a private party or in an appeals court.

A mesothelioma case may require multiple sessions of mediation and negotiations before settling. During this process attorneys and defense lawyers will discuss documents and conduct depositions with witnesses (written or in-person interviews). A mesothelioma attorney is experienced in negotiating a settlement for their clients. They will ensure that the client receives the most lucrative settlement due to their asbestos exposure.

Trials

A successful mesothelioma claim can help victims and their families receive compensation for medical expenses or lost income. Compensation also can be granted for pain and suffering. These payments may also be used to cover funeral costs and the loss of a loved ones. Mesothelioma settlements and jury awards can differ depending on the state's laws and evidence, the number of companies involved in the case, and other factors. A mesothelioma lawyer who is experienced can explain how these factors may affect a settlement offer or a verdict at trial.

The first step in a mesothelioma lawsuit is to establish a strong case. A legal team can interview current and ex-workers to gather information on asbestos exposure. The lawyer can then make a claim for mesothelioma law against the responsible companies.

The exchange of evidence and documents between the two sides could take months. During this time attorneys can also conduct depositions, where they ask the victims and their family members questions under the oath. Patients with mesothelioma may also be asked testify in court. Each victim decides whether or not to testify.

Mesothelioma trial verdicts often result in higher payouts than settlements, but they aren't any guarantee of compensation. If the defendants do not agree with the verdict, they may appeal it to be reduced or overturned. This can tie up the victim's compensation for a long time.

Mesothelioma lawsuits can be a bit complicated even though most trials are only several hours. It requires a lawyer who has experience handling asbestos cases, especially those against large companies. A lawyer can handle the details of a mesothelioma lawsuit to allow their client to concentrate on treatment.

Mesothelioma lawyers usually attempt to settle cases outside of court. If a client doesn't like the settlement offer, their lawyer will prepare for an trial. The jury will decide the amount of compensation to the victim's family or for themselves following the trial.

Attorneys

A qualified mesothelioma law firm will handle all aspects of the case, including the filing of paperwork, taking depositions and negotiation of settlements. The goal is to provide compensation that covers all medical expenses, lost wages and other costs associated with the asbestos-related disease. The lawyers also will help family members and victims receive financial support through asbestos trust funds that pay compensation to those who have been exposed to toxic substances.

The lawyers of the best mesothelioma law firms have years of experience in representing clients across the nation and around the world. They have a history of achieving significant financial compensation for their clients and holding corporations accountable for exposing them asbestos. They have the expertise to handle both personal injury claims as well as wrongful death cases.

The surviving family members can bring a lawsuit to claim wrongful death if the deceased person died of mesothelioma or a different asbestos-related disease. Family members include spouses siblings, children parents, grandchildren and grandparents. The estate of the victim's victims can also file a lawsuit to claim mesothelioma-related mesothelioma wrongful as well as their beneficiaries or representatives.

Personal injury lawsuits constitute the majority of mesothelioma lawsuits. They seek compensation from the asbestos company accountable for the exposure of their clients and make them liable for negligence.

While asbestos exposure is the most frequent mesothelioma cause, a lot of people were exposed to asbestos from secondhand sources. This includes wives who cleaned off their husband's work attire or washed his uniforms, and neighbors of workers in asbestos-producing plants.

Mesothelioma lawyers should be familiar of the laws and lawsuits concerning asbestos in every state in which they practice. They should also have a team of skilled investigators to determine the sources of exposure, review medical records and evaluate the client's diagnosis.

An attorney for mesothelioma should be familiar with all kinds of asbestos litigation, including claims to compensation from asbestos trust funds or veterans benefits. The best firms will be proficient in personal injury and wrongful death claims and will be able to file these types of claims in every state in which they practice.
